    I've been with Android since mid-July. I still have my 9900 but I'm just not using it. The Android Kindle app has a lot to do with that. I use it quite a bit, and it just works better than the BB OS6 app. One app can be a dealmaker or dealbreaker, and for me Kindle is very important. For someone else it could be Skype, or whatever.

    I did use WP7 for about three months last spring, but only for a few days at a time, always switching back to BB. The Kindle app for WP7 was a 1.0 version, like the BB OS 6 one, so it didn't give me added incentive to stay with WP7. I don't know if the app has been upgraded since then.

    I know that I won't move to BB10 if it doesn't have a good Kindle app. I'm more invested in Kindle books than I am in any smartphone platform, and I do read on my phone a fair amount of the time.
